8 kg heroin seized in Abohar-Fazilka sector

Fazilka, May 4 (UNI) BSF personnel today recovered eight kg heroin, worth Rs eight crore in the international market, near a border outpost (BOP) in Abohar-Fazilka sector.

Some of the contraband was packed in 129 capsules totally weighing 1.5 kg, which was a novel mode in this region while the rest was packaged in the usual powder form, DIG BSF Abohar sub-sector V K Sharma told UNI. In all there were eight packets of heroin, he added.

According to Mr Sharma, the BSF had been maintaing extra vigil in the region due to apprehensions of a spurt in the smuggling activities during the harvest season.

The BSF personel today found the narcotic consignment hidden under a mulberry tree outside a mazar near BOP GG-1.

''The smugglers had used the ''conceal and clear'' method but before the contraband could be picked by the contact, alert BSF personnel who were scanning the area, recovered it, '' the DIG said.

All the packets had PTTE-HAD written prominently and attempts were on to 'crack' the marking, he added.

The seized contranband has been handed over to the local police which has registered a case under NDPS. No arrests were made in this connection so far, Mr Sharma said.
